A RuH2(CO)(PPh3)3-Catalyzed Regioselective Arylation of Aromatic Ketones with Arylboronates via Carbon-Hydrogen Bond Cleavage

Abstract

The ortho-arylation of aromatic ketones with arylboronates using RuH2(CO)(PPh3)3 as a catalyst was conducted in pinacolone. This solvent dramatically suppressed the competing reduction of the aromatic ketones and, as a result, ortho-arylated products were obtained in high yield. The mechanism is discussed.
